Comprehending the Different Types of Treadmills


When strolling into a reputable treadmill shop, buyers will come across numerous distinct categories of devices, each designed to meet particular fitness requirements and space restrictions. Understanding these differences forms the foundation of an informed acquiring decision.

Manual treadmills represent the many basic choice offered in a lot of stores. These devices run without electrical motors, suggesting the belt moves only when the user walks or runs. While they tend to be more budget-friendly and compact, manual treadmills can position additional pressure on joints given that the user should generate all forward momentum. They work well for individuals who mostly plan light walking or who have actually limited flooring space in their homes.

Motorized treadmills control the commercial and home fitness market, using automated incline settings, pre-programmed exercise programs, and constant belt speeds. These makers range from fundamental models appropriate for strolling to advanced units designed for high-intensity interval training and severe runners. The quality of the motor, determined in constant horsepower, significantly impacts the maker's efficiency and longevity. A quality treadmill store will generally stock models covering multiple horse power rankings to accommodate different workout strengths.

Folding treadmills have actually acquired remarkable appeal among home physical fitness lovers who should stabilize their workout devices with minimal home. These devices include hydraulic systems that enable the deck to raise vertically after usage, sometimes reducing the footprint by half. Modern designs have actually decreased the standard compromise between folding convenience and structural stability, with many designs providing the very same robust building as their non-folding equivalents.

Commercial-grade treadmills found in specialized treadmill shops stand up to constant use in physical fitness centers and frequently feature much heavier frames, more powerful motors, and additional cushioning systems. While these machines carry higher cost points, their resilience and advanced functions make them appealing to severe runners and those preparing regular day-to-day use.

Important Features to Evaluate


Beyond basic classifications, an educated treadmill store agent can assist shoppers through the technical specs that identify quality devices from substandard choices. The running surface area measurements rank amongst the most critical considerations, as inadequate belt length can interfere with natural stride patterns and increase injury danger. hometreadmills determine 55 to 60 inches in length and 20 to 22 inches in width, though taller or bigger people might need prolonged dimensions.

Motor power straight associates with smooth operation and the machine's capability to keep consistent speeds under varying user weights. Continuous duty horse power, rather than peak horsepower, supplies the most precise performance indicator. Treadmills intended for strolling typically require 2.0 to 2.5 CHP, while running and training applications benefit from 3.0 CHP or higher. Shoppers ought to verify that the motor specification reflects continuousduty rankings, as some producers list peak performance numbers that overestimate real-world capabilities.

Cushioning systems should have attention from buyers concerned about joint health. Quality treadmills include elastomeric cushions or similar shock-absorption systems in between the deck and frame, minimizing effect forces by 15 to 40 percent compared to outdoor running surfaces. This function shows particularly important for much heavier users, older grownups, and people with pre-existing joint conditions.

Console innovation has actually progressed drastically in the last few years, transforming treadmills into sophisticated entertainment and tracking centers. Fundamental consoles display screen speed, range, time, and calorie expenditure, while sophisticated units consist of touchscreen screens, interactive workout programs, heart rate tracking, and integration with physical fitness apps and streaming services. Buyers need to consider how smartphone connectivity, Bluetooth compatibility, and built-in workout range line up with their inspirational needs and tech preferences.

Picking a Reputable Treadmill Shop


The purchase experience matters as much as the devices itself. A reliable treadmill store utilizes knowledgeable personnel who can assess individual fitness objectives, space restraints, and spending plan factors to consider before recommending specific designs. These specialists must show patience in addressing questions, offer test chances on floor designs, and offer transparent information about warranty coverage and upkeep requirements.

Post-purchase assistance identifies outstanding sellers from merely adequate ones. Quality treadmill stores offer shipment services, assembly options, and continuous maintenance support. They need to supply clear information about replacement parts availability, service technician schedule, and reaction times for guarantee claims. Some shops keep service departments with certified technicians who can carry out repairs and routine maintenance, extending the equipment's operational life expectancy.

Budget Considerations and Value Assessment


Developing a reasonable budget helps narrow choices efficiently throughout the shopping process. While temptation exists to acquire the least expensive design available, this method typically leads to early equipment failure, poor exercise experiences, and ultimately greater long-lasting expenses. Industry professionals generally advise assigning at least ₤ 1,000 to ₤ 1,500 for a home treadmill meant for regular use, with ₤ 2,000 to ₤ 3,000 offering the optimal balance of functions, building and construction quality, and toughness for most homes.

Buyers must thoroughly analyze warranty terms before purchasing. Quality treadmills usually include lifetime protection on frames, extended guarantees on motors and electronic devices, and labor coverage for the very first year or more. A treadmill shop offering suspiciously low rates alongside very little warranty coverage may be offering terminated models with minimal parts schedule or reconditioned devices with doubtful reliability.

Financing options merit consideration for purchasers buying higher-end devices. Many specialty treadmill stores work together with consumer credit companies to use promotional interest rates or payment strategies that distribute expenses over several months. These plans can make premium designs economically available while enabling purchasers to take advantage of enhanced construction and features that support long-lasting fitness success.

Regularly Asked Questions


How much space does a typical treadmill need?

Many standard treadmills require around 7 feet in length, 3 feet in width, and 5 to 6 feet in height when in use. Folding models minimize the horizontal footprint considerably when kept, though buyers ought to validate the unfolded and folded dimensions before acquiring. Measuring the intended installation area, including clearance for access and emergency dismounts, prevents frustrating收货后安装 obstacles.

What maintenance do treadmills regularly need?

Routine upkeep consists of weekly belt cleaning, month-to-month lubrication of the strolling belt, routine belt tension adjustment, and routine vacuuming underneath and around the device. Many quality treadmills consist of lubrication sets and maintenance schedules in their user handbooks. Avoiding extreme wear, keeping the maker on proper floor covering, and attending to unusual noises quickly extend operational life expectancy significantly.

Is a treadmill purchase worthwhile for someone who mostly strolls?

Definitely. Treadmills offer constant, shock-absorbing surfaces ideal for strolling workout. Modern machines use slope capabilities that increase cardiovascular advantages without impact strength, while pre-programmed programs assist keep exercise variety and motivation. The benefit of home treadmill gain access to frequently increases exercise frequency compared to counting on outside walking or gym gos to.

The length of time do home treadmills usually last?

With proper upkeep and reasonable use patterns, quality home treadmills last 7 to 12 years. Motors and electronic devices typically carry warranties of 5 to 10 years from reputable makers. Equipment lifespan associates strongly with preliminary purchase quality, with budget models generally needing replacement after 3 to 5 years of regular usage.
